The Cuba Solidarity Campaign is the British campaign against the illegal blockade of Cuba and for the Cuban peoples’ right to self-determination and national sovereignty.  US hostility to Cuba continues today despite twenty specific UN General Assembly resolutions, passed with overwhelming majorities, demanding the total, immediate and unconditional lifting of the US blockade.  This blockade is the most enduring in history and is estimated to have cost the Cuban economy 96 billion dollars in the last 50 years.  The US blockade is a commercial, economic and financial embargo which began in October 1960 – following the successful Cuban revolution of 1959.
